fun extract()

in plugins/src/main/kotlin/org/jetbrains/gradle/plugins/terraform/tasks/TerraformExtract.kt [23:29]


    fun extract() {
        project.zipTree(configuration.resolve().single()).first {
            it.nameWithoutExtension == "terraform"
                    && if (OperatingSystem.current().isWindows) it.extension == "exe" else true
        }.copyTo(outputExecutable, true)
        if (OperatingSystem.current().isUnix) outputExecutable.setExecutable(true)
    }